### Step 4: Configure the Occupancy Feed Credential

Plugins for the Stallward garage platform consume the live occupancy feed over the authenticated push channel. Before your plugin can subscribe, the host expects a feed credential in its environment; without it, the channel handshake fails silently and your plugin receives zero updates. Obtain the credential from your Stallward integration contact, then add the following line to your plugin's env file.

vault entry, kafog-yahop: COURIER_KEY8=0faa53ae

Welcome to the Keldrum storage team. Every read to the Pell key-value store first passes through a bloom filter layer called Sift. Sift avoids disk lookups for keys that definitely don't exist, which cuts read latency by roughly 40% under normal load. False positives are expected and harmless; false negatives are impossible by design. Full tuning parameters and rebuild schedules are documented on the internal page below.

operations page: https://confluence.qorvellabs.internal/pages/projects/projects/projects

## Crash Pipeline — Onboarding

The Fernvale app ships crash reports to the intake worker, which dedupes by stack hash and writes batches to the reports store. Workers are stateless; scale them freely. Symbols live in the artifact cache and rotate weekly. If dedupe lags, check the hash queue first. To inspect stored reports locally, connect to the reports database using the string below.

database URL for tajog-bajeg: mysql://soreth_svc:OzsCjhu@db-6997.nelvrostack.internal:5432/kelax